Transaction 905e9526906e15b163612dec1bb8a78f1a99208ea4893f507a574d1516baa7d6
1 Input
1 Output
-
905e9526906e15b163612dec1bb8a78f1a99208ea4893f507a574d1516baa7d6:0
- value
- 114326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 299d1908df7761adcb7405cd13eb27fc15f6dfe7 OP_EQUAL
- address
- 35V3pkj9BCY1c4Bby6tn9bV15hZZziK52C